Marvel has revealed new character posters for Marvel's The Avengers featuring Scarlett Johansson as Black Widow, Mark Ruffalo as The Hulk, Jeremy Renner as Hawkeye, Chris Evans as Captain America and Robert Downey Jr. as Iron Man.

Black Widow Poster
Hulk Poster
RELATED: The Marvels Director Nia DaCosta Blames Captain America for the Snap
Captain America Poster
Iron Man Poster